Overview

This compound is a synthetic small molecule belonging to the class of hybrid peptides. It features a diazepane core substituted with an amino-trifluorophenyl butanoyl group. The structure and related intermediates are associated with research into dipeptidyl peptidase IV (DPP-IV or DPP4) inhibition—a mechanism relevant for antidiabetic drugs such as sitagliptin. However, this specific compound is primarily referenced in chemical and pharmacological databases as an experimental or research molecule rather than a marketed pharmaceutical product[1][8]. Its main scientific interest lies in its potential as a selective DPP-IV inhibitor.
